Just got back from the Dads & Donuts event at the school. Despite its popularity, I see the event being cancelled in the near future. Last year, they moved the event from the auditorium (easy monitoring) to the lunch arbor (open access) and were dismayed to discover that when a new box of doughnuts was placed on a table, a swarm of kids would descend--with the end result of some kids getting 10 or 12 and some parents getting none (I was lucky to get one last year). To combat this, they attempted to enforce a 1-doughnut apiece strategy, with kids getting their hands stamped and adults going by the honor system. This resulted in some kids using the bathroom to wash their hands (and remove the hand stamp) and fewer adults staying around and socializing. It also resulted in at least 5 boxes of doughnuts going untouched--a situation greeted by surprise by the organizers.

The event also came under fire, as some people complained that the event was only for dads (which, while often predominantly attended by men, is not necessarily true, as moms who show up are never turned away). Some complained that there is no "Moms and Mimosas" event--despite the fact that there are Mother's Day events (either by the school as a whole--such as Moms and Muffins--or by each class) and Father's Day falls after the end of the school year. So maybe it should be called "Donuts with parents who are often not considered to be the primary care-giver or who are generally too lazy to drop their kid off at school and force another to do so."
